Re: Free space on Linux Drive



John, you wrote:
> I think this a simple enough question, but even my Unix teacher can't
> answer it.  I just installed Debian on my 586 Windoze machine, with a 200mb
> partition.  The first time I installed it on 100 megs but I ran out of
> room.  My question is how can I check how much space is left on my Linux
> partition.  I DOS, I can use chkdsk, is there a similiar function in Linux?
> 
  Now, that's some Unix teacher :-)

  Try 'df' (Disk Free)... it should give you the information you need.  For
other options for 'df' see the manual page 'man df'.
